1. What is an Image to GIF Converter?

An Image to GIF Converter is a tool that takes a sequence of static images (like a series of JPEGs or PNGs) and compiles them into a single, animated GIF (Graphics Interchange Format) file.

Think of it as a digital flip-book. You provide the individual pages (the static images), and the converter binds them together into a moving picture.

What is a GIF?

  • Origin: An old format, created by CompuServe in 1987.

  • Primary Purpose: To create simple, looping animations in a small file size that was manageable for the slow internet speeds of the past.

  • Key Characteristics & Limitations:

    1. Limited Color Palette: A GIF file can only contain a maximum of 256 colors (8-bit color). The converter must create a single palette that best represents all the colors from all the source images, which can lead to color banding or "dithering" (using dot patterns to simulate more colors).

    2. Basic Transparency: It supports only 1-bit transparency. This means a pixel is either 100% transparent or 100% opaque—there are no semi-transparent effects. This can result in jagged edges on graphics with smooth outlines.

    3. Lossless (with a catch): The compression is lossless, but only within its own 256-color palette. The quality loss happens during the initial conversion of the source images to this limited palette.

    4. Animation: Its ability to store multiple frames with individual display delays is its defining feature.

2. Why Would You Convert Images to GIF?

Despite its technical limitations, the GIF format remains incredibly popular for several key reasons:

  • Universal Compatibility: This is GIF's superpower. A GIF will play on virtually any web browser, email client, or operating system made in the last 25 years without any special plugins. It just works.

  • Creating Memes and Reactions: The short, looping, silent nature of GIFs has made them the dominant format for internet memes and expressive reactions on social media (Twitter, Reddit) and messaging apps (WhatsApp, Discord).

  • Simple Demonstrations: It's perfect for quickly showing a short process, like a few steps in a software tutorial or a simple product demonstration.

  • Web UI Elements: For a long time, GIFs were used for simple loading spinners and hover effects. (Though this is now often better handled by modern CSS or SVG animations).

  • Email Marketing: Since video support in emails is very poor, an animated GIF is a reliable way to add eye-catching motion to a marketing email.

3. How Do These Converters Work?

The process is a sequence of assembly and optimization:

  1. Input: The user provides a sequence of ordered images (e.g., frame_01.png, frame_02.png, frame_03.png, ...). Video files can also be used as a source, where the converter first extracts frames from the video.

  2. Set Animation Parameters: The user configures how the animation should behave:

    • Frame Delay (or Frame Rate): How long each individual frame should be displayed, usually measured in hundredths of a second.

    • Loop Count: Whether the animation should play once, loop a specific number of times, or loop infinitely.

  3. Color Palette Optimization (The Critical Step):

    • The converter analyzes all the colors across all the source frames.

    • It then generates a single "global color table" with a maximum of 256 colors that best represents the entire animation.

    • All frames are then re-mapped to this limited palette. This is where color degradation occurs. Advanced converters use dithering to create the illusion of more colors and smoother gradients.

  4. Assembly and Compression: The tool assembles the re-colored frames in order, attaches the timing and looping information, and applies LZW lossless compression to the data.

  5. Save: The final compiled animation is saved as a single .gif file.

4. Types of Images to GIF Converters

a) Online Converters (Most Popular)

These websites are incredibly popular and easy to use.

  • Examples:

    • EZGIF.com: The undisputed king of online GIF tools. It offers "GIF Maker," "Video to GIF," and many other optimization and editing tools.

    • GIPHY, Imgur: These platforms are not just hosts; they have tools to create GIFs from videos (like YouTube links) or image uploads.

    • CloudConvert, Online-Convert.com: General file converters that also support creating GIFs from image sequences.

  • Pros: Very easy to use, no installation, often free.

  • Cons: Privacy concerns, file size/frame number limits, requires internet.

b) Desktop Software

Applications you install for more power and privacy.

  • Professional Editors:

    • Adobe Photoshop: A very powerful way to create high-quality GIFs. You can use the "Timeline" panel to arrange video or image layers as frames and then use the File > Export > Save for Web (Legacy) dialog to fine-tune the color palette, dithering, and compression.

    • Adobe Premiere/After Effects: These video editors can also export directly to an animated GIF format.

  • Free Editors:

    • GIMP: Allows you to load images as layers (where each layer is a frame) and then export as a GIF, with control over frame delay and looping.

    • ScreenToGif (Windows): A fantastic free tool that can record your screen, webcam, or an existing drawing, and can also import image sequences to create a GIF.
